Would love to hear suggestions on where to travel next for our diving holiday. We can easily get into visiting the same places which we absolutely love and keep going back to. There is so much out there on our bucket lit and would like somewhere exotic, warm, with great beaches, and more of a local vibe where we can immerse ourselves.

We love Thailand overall Ko Tao, Ko Samui, Khao Lak, Similian Islands. Had a great time in Bali loving Nusa Lembognan and Candidasa areas. Had an amazing time in Galapagos and also liked Isla Mujeres. All had relatively warm temperatures and a great combination of diving and local experience. We are not into more populated, fancier places which are more city like versus local dive communities. Where would you go next.

Raja Ampat and Komodo are are on our list. Would also consider Papaua New Guinea, Sipidan, Malaysia or somewhere in Vietnam. Considered Maldives and Seychelles think it may be more luxurious and less local. We do have two tickets on Qatar therefore leaving some South American, Caribbean bucket lists for another year along with a future planned Philippines.

Would love to hear places you could spend a couple weeks exploring.

I have been to Vietnam to both travel and dive. I would consider it more of a travel/vacation spot where you can find some decent diving in a couple of places, but I wouldn't consider it a dedicated dive destination. What time of year and how much time (including travel to and from) are you working with? Sounds like you'd prefer land based over a live aboard, is that correct?
 
We are pretty open at present but thinking between June and October. We just did a longer liveaboard and it was amazing in the Galapagos but thinking this time we would like a combination to offset the last one. I'm not opposed to doing a short liveabord 3/4 days and then land time too.

We are not so into muck diving is the one thing although can appreciate a dive or two here and there of such.

Have not done Vietnam, Combodia or Malaysia so pretty unfamiliar with towns and diving other than what we are researching. Could do Thailand or Indonesia again which are our regulars. =) Just looking for new suggestions.

Got it and thanks for the extra info. I personally wouldn't consider Vietnam, Peninsular Malaysia or Cambodia for "dive dedicated" vacations. I have lived or traveled in them extensively and love them all, but not for that purpose. East Malaysia is another story and definitely worth considering. But, based on everything you have stated so far about your preferences, the June to October time frame and the Qatar Airlines tickets, I would probably be looking at Komodo or Sulawesi. There are some people here on the Board with extensive experience in that region who would be very helpful. @Luko is one such person that comes to mind.

Fiji is another place to consider, but wasn't on your bucket list.
